Ornithological Survey

Common Name: Northern Flicker

Scientific Name (Genus-species): Colaptes auratus

Length (bill-tail): 12 1/2"

Identifying Chacteristics: black crest on chest, red streak under bill, black spotted under feathers

bores large holes in dead trees and wood sided homes

male attracts mate by hammering on metal chimneys

Habitat: open pine forests

Perrenial
